How they compare

Saint Lucia currently reports 76.65 1000 USD against 62.26 1000 USD in South Sudan, a difference of 14.39 1000 USD.

That makes Saint Lucia's figure about 1.2 times South Sudan's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 5 shared years of data; in 2016 it was Saint Lucia ahead.

South Sudan ranks 167th and Saint Lucia ranks 164th of 200 countries.

Saint Lucia has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
